I have been practicing Aikido, a Japanese martial art, for several years now. The term Aikido refers to the martial art itself, and the suffix ka(家, -ka) indicates that someone practices it. This is how I came up with my forum username.

As an Aikidoka, I have received training in Aikido's principles, techniques, and philosophy, and my level of skill and expertise in the martial art is recognized. Aikido plays a significant role in my life as it helps me relax and utilize my inner body energy, making me feel better both inside and outside of the gym. My name on the forum is inspired by a true Roman soldier, centurion Lucius Vorenus who was a member of the famous XI Legion (Legio undecima Claudia) formed by Julius Caesar to invade Gallia in 58 BC. He became known for his courage along with his friend Titus Pullo, and it was mentioned in Julius Caesar Commentāriī dē Bellō Gallicō.

Based on these events, a series called Rome was filmed and it was one of the most-watched series with very high ratings (8.7 from 10).
